India’s exports to US fall 13% in Feb

India's exports to the United States dropped 13% in February, signaling a significant decline in bilateral trade flows. The fall may reflect shifts in demand, tariff pressures, or global supply chain disruptions. This development has implications for Indian markets and trade policy.
